#3. Monitor and Analyze the Market
A key part of trading is analyzing the market and predicting future trends. Keeping track of market data and news is one of the most effective methods to learn trading. Regularly checking the market helps you identify patterns and make better investment decisions.
There are two main types of analysis to focus on:
- Fundamental Analysis: This method evaluates the intrinsic value of a stock or asset by examining both qualitative and quantitative factors. It also considers broader economic factors rather than just market price fluctuations.
- Technical Analysis: Here, you study historical prices and use patterns to predict future price movements. Traders use this method to identify potential buy or sell signals based on past market behavior.
Both types of analysis can help you become more confident in your trades and enhance your chances of success.

#6. Practice with Demo Accounts
The final tip in any guide on methods to learn trading is to practice! Many trading platforms provide demo accounts for trading with virtual money. These accounts allow you to test your strategies without risking your real capital. Regular practice helps you get used to market changes and make better decisions.
